978,672,007,754,728 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 978672007754728 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 5 prime factors (large circles) and 64 divisors.

978672007754728 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of sixty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 978672007754728:

23 × 7 × 29 × 891493 × 675979

(2 × 2 × 2 × 7 × 29 × 891493 × 675979)
